Дебиан 11. Интерфейс сотовой сети прекращает передачу данных, если значение MTU было изменено.

Вопрос или проблема

У меня проблема с сотовым модемом, когда я изменяю настройку MTU для интерфейса мобильной сети.

Настройки:

  • debian 11
  • стандартный размер MTU от мобильного оператора 1430
  • требуемый размер MTU для северного соединения 1300

Поведение: после изменения размера MTU устройство работает правильно несколько минут, а затем теряет северное соединение.

Изменение MTU для такого же оборудования с тем же мобильным оператором работало хорошо на debian 9.

Заранее спасибо.

.

Ответ или решение

Решение проблемы с MTU в Debian 11 при использовании сотовой сети

Ваш вопрос касается проблемы с интерфейсом сотовой сети в Debian 11, который прекращает передачу данных после изменения значения MTU. Ваша система настроена с MTU по умолчанию от мобильного оператора 1430, однако требуется значение MTU в размере 1300 для севернонаправленного подключения. Проблема проявляется в том, что после изменения MTU устройство работает нормально несколько минут, но затем утрачивает севернонаправленное подключение. Любопытно, что на Debian 9 с тем же оборудованием и мобильным оператором таких проблем не возникало.

Причины проблемы и возможные решения

При изменении значения MTU возможны следующие причины и решения проблемы:

1. Изменения в сетевой архитектуре и конфигурации Debian 11

Debian 11 ввел изменения в сетевые компоненты и драйверы, включая обновленные версии ядра и систем, которые могут влиять на поведение сетевых адаптеров. Это может привести к различному поведению по сравнению с Debian 9.

Решение: Проверьте изменения в конфигурации сетевых адаптеров и примените настройки, соответствующие новым требованиям системы.

2. Драйверы и прошивки модема

Проблема может быть связана с несовместимостью или ошибками в драйверах и прошивке сотового модема, которые могут проявляться при изменении MTU.

Решение: Обновите драйверы модема и прошивку до последних версий, совместимых с Debian 11. Проверьте лог-файлы для выявления ошибок при изменении MTU.

3. Конфликт настроек сетевого стека

Неправильная конфигурация сетевой подсистемы может вызывать утрату связи. Например, кое-какие стандартные параметры могли измениться в новой версии.

Решение: Откройте и проверьте конфигурационные файлы для сетевых интерфейсов, такие как /etc/network/interfaces, а также настройки systemd-networkd или NetworkManager, если они используются.

4. Проверка маршрутизации и правил сети

Изменение MTU может нарушать существующие правила маршрутизации и сетевых фильтров, что приводит к разрыву соединения.

Решение: Проверьте маршрутные таблицы и правила сетевого фильтрации командой ip route и iptables, чтобы убедиться, что они корректно учитывают новое значение MTU.

Заключение

Изменение значения MTU в Debian 11 может вызывать ряд проблем, уникальных для новой версии системы и ее компонентов. Для решения данной проблемы рекомендуется провести комплексное обновление драйверов, проверить конфигурации и локальные правила маршрутизации. Если проблема persists, рассмотреть возможность обратиться к поддержке вашего мобильного оператора или в сообщество Debian для получения дополнительных советов.

Оцените материал
Добавить комментарий

Капча загружается...